Memory Aid Glasses (or mic)

Helps you remember where you are, how you got here, and where you wanna go

What was i saying, oh yeah...

Never get lost again. Never forget what you wanted to do. Never forget how to get back from where you are.

You have this tiny hidden camera following you werever you go. It only records if you turn left/right or go streight. Then when you discover your lost, you can retrieve the info (it prints it out on the glasses, or just gives you a little pinch in the correct direction each time you reach an intersection (and press the bridge over your nose).

Couple this with a mic, so you say what you wanted to do, and it asks you every five minutes (or when you press the bridge again... you can configure it this way or the other) if you accomplished what you were set out to do. This way, when you're distracted you are constantly reminded of what you should be doing and if

sorry, i just remembered what i was supposed to be doing.
